This sake pourer with purple thistles and orange peonies shows off Seif? Yohei III’s technique of enamels painted over the glaze. Sake Pourer with Flowers, 1893–1914. Seifū Yohei III (Japanese, 1851–1914). Porcelain with molded design, overglaze color enamel, and metal handles; diameter: cm (4 in.); width with spout: cm (5 3/16 in.); with handle: cm (5 11/16 in.).
